New to posting and any help on this would be appreciated greatly. I presently have the opportunity to buy a set of SE pipes for my 09' heritage classic for a great price. The problem is I have been unable to find the answer if they will fit or not. I have called two HD dealerships and got a yes they will fit from one and a no from the other. The part #'s are 80510-07 and 80511-07.

Those are actually the part numbers individually for the kit 80495-07. Everything I saw shows it should fit all 08 and newer 49 state Softails with shorty exhaust. Good luck

Number 80510-07 is the rear muffler and number 80511-07 is the front muffler, I don't know why they don't call them bottom and top muffler instead of front and rear? Is this how one looks? I can also agree that according to the book they will fit. If you need new clamps the part numbers are 65283-94. Here are the Original Instructions from Harley Davidson.
